Knowledge Builders

what is a double value

by Dr. Reilly Robel I Published 3 years ago Updated 2 years ago
image

The double is a fundamental data type built into the compiler and used to define numeric variables holding numbers with decimal points. C, C++, C# and many other programming languages recognize the double as a type. A double type can represent fractional as well as whole values.

The doubleValue() is a method of Java Number class which returns the value of the specified number casted as a double equivalent. This method may also involve in rounding or truncation.

Full Answer

What is the use of doublevalue () method?

The doubleValue () method returns the double value represented by this object. System.out.println ( "Result after being converted to double value = "+obj1.doubleValue ()); Double is a primitive data type. Its object cannot be used to call the Double class method.

What is an a double type variable?

A double type variable is a 64-bit floating data type. David Bolton is a software developer who has worked for several major firms, including Morgan Stanley, PwC, BAE Systems, and LCH. The double is a fundamental data type built into the compiler and used to define numeric variables holding numbers with decimal points.

What is a double in programming?

The double is a fundamental data type built into the compiler and used to define numeric variables holding numbers with decimal points.

What is double data type in C?

A double is a data type in C language that stores high-precision floating-point data or numbers in computer memory. It is called double data type because it can hold the double size of data compared to the float data type. A double has 8 bytes, which is equal to 64 bits in size.

How many digits are in a double?

What is double type in C++?

Why is float faster than double?

About this website

image

How do you define double value?

The doubleValue() method is a static method of Integer class under java. lang package. This method returns the value of this Integer as a double equivalent. This method is specified by Number class and may involve rounding or truncation.

How do you write a double value?

Example 2public class Double_doubleValueMethod_Example2 {public static void main(String[] args) {double obj1=5.7;System.out.println("double value = "+obj1);System.out.println( "Result after being converted to double value = "+obj1.doubleValue());}}

What is double example?

To get a double of a number, we add the same number to itself. For example, double of 2 is 2 + 2 = 4. Example: Michelle has 4 marbles and Jane has double the marbles that Michelle has.

What is double data type?

Double (double-precision floating-point) variables are stored as IEEE 64-bit (8-byte) floating-point numbers ranging in value from: -1.79769313486231E308 to -4.94065645841247E-324 for negative values. 4.94065645841247E-324 to 1.79769313486232E308 for positive values.

How many decimal places is a double?

double is a 64-bit IEEE 754 double precision Floating Point Number – 1 bit for the sign, 11 bits for the exponent, and 52* bits for the value. double has 15 decimal digits of precision.

What is the difference between float and double?

float and double both have varying capacities when it comes to the number of decimal digits they can hold. float can hold up to 7 decimal digits accurately while double can hold up to 15.

What is the double of 8?

16The double of 8 is 16.

What is the double of 100?

If it is of the initial value, a 100% increase doubles it. For example, if you start with 100, a 10% rise is to 110. A 50% rise is to 150, and a 100% rise is to 200.

What is the double of 9?

The answer of double 9 is 18.

What is double value in C?

The double in C is a data type that is used to store high-precision floating-point data or numbers (up to 15 to 17 digits). It is used to store large values of decimal numbers. Values that are stored are double the size of data that can be stored in the float data type. Thus it is named a double data type.

What is difference between int and double?

An int is an integer, which you might remember from math is a whole number. A double is a number with a decimal. The number 1 is an integer while the number 1.0 is a double.

What is double in data structure?

Double is also a datatype which is used to represent the floating point numbers. It is a 64-bit IEEE 754 double precision floating point number for the value. It has 15 decimal digits of precision.

What is the double of 24?

the double of 24 is 48 can you find double of 24 by any other method .

What is the double of 23?

Solution. 23 x 41 = 943, which is equal to what we just calculated! If we collect all of the multiplications by 2 – which is what is happening with doubling each time – the numbers on the list are equal to 23 x 1, 23 x 2, 23 x 4, 23 x 8, 23 x 16, 23 x 32.

What is the double of 5?

10“Doubles” are easily connected to familiar situations, e.g. two hands show that “double 5 is 10”, and an egg carton shows “double 6 is 12.”

What is the double of 14?

The double of 14 is 28.

What does double? mean in C#? - Stack Overflow

Possible Duplicate: C# newbie: what’s the difference between “bool” and “bool?” ? Hi, While reading the code of the NUnit project's assert class, I came across...

Difference between float and double in C/C++ - GeeksforGeeks

To represent floating point numbers, we use float, double and long double.What’s the difference? double has 2x more precision than float.float is a 32-bit IEEE 754 single precision Floating Point Number – 1 bit for the sign, 8 bits for the exponent, and 23* for the value. float has 7 decimal digits of precision.double is a 64-bit IEEE 754 double precision Floating Point Number – 1 bit ...

Float and Double in C - tutorialspoint.com

Float and Double in C - FloatFloat is a datatype which is used to represent the floating point numbers. It is a 32-bit IEEE 754 single precision floating point ...

double Keyword in C# - GeeksforGeeks

Keywords are the words in a language that are used for some internal process or represent some predefined actions. It is a keyword that is used to declare a variable that can store a floating-point value from the range of ±5.0 x 10-324 to ±1.7 x 10 308.It is an alias of System.Double.

What is double in C - javatpoint

In the above program, we use a sizeof() function to get the size of an integer, float, character, and double data types bypassing the int, char, float, and double as the parameter.. Program to convert feet into meter using the double data type. Let's consider an example to pass the double data number as the parameter to a function and then convert the feet into meters.

Why do we use double data?

It is usually used to deal with the huge computation of numbers and mantissa for precision makes . Many programmers choose the double data type because it gives accurate decimal-related results for complex numbers.

What is double data type?

A double is a data type in C language that stores high-precision floating-point data or numbers in computer memory. It is called double data type because it can hold the double size of data compared to the float data type. A double has 8 bytes, which is equal to 64 bits in size. In double data type, the 1 bit for sign representation, 11 bits for the exponent and the remaining 52 bits used for the mantissa. The range of double is 1.7E-308 to 1.7E+308. Double data can be represents in real number (1, 10), decimals (0.1, 11.002) and minus (-1, -0.00002). It can hold approximately 15 to 16 digits before and after the decimal point.

Can you declare a variable name in a single line?

Furthermore, we can declare and initialize the variable name in a single line.

What is a float and double?

Float and double are primitive data types used by programming languages to store floating-point real (decimal) numbers like 10.923455, 433.45554598 and so on. This article will give you the detailed difference between float and double data type.

What is the difference between float and double in Java?

Double is the default decimal point type for Java. If high precision is not required and the program only needs a huge array of decimal numbers to be stored, float is a cost-effective way of storing data and saves memory. Double is costlier, occupies more space and is more effective when more precision is required.

How many digits does num1 return?

While num1 returns the value as 333.602081, num2 declared as double returns 333.6020814126, which is precise upto 10 digits as mentioned in our printf statement. We can also print a float as a double and vice versa, it all depends on how we write the printf statement. Writing %f will strip off some significant digits, while when we specify number of digits, the entire value up till that will be printed. To print the value in exponential terms, you should use “%e”.

Why is decimal used in Java?

For more accurate calculations like in financial and banking applications, Decimal is used because it further reduces rounding errors.

Which is more accurate, double or float?

Double is more precise and for storing large numbers, we prefer double over float. For example, to store the annual salary of the CEO of a company, double will be a more accurate choice. All trigonometric functions like sin, cos, tan, mathematical functions like sqrt return double values. However, double comes with a cost. Unless we do need precision up to 15 or 16 decimal points, we can stick to float in most applications, as double is more expensive. It takes about 8 bytes to store a variable. We append ‘f’ or ‘F’ to the number to indicate that it is float type failing which it is taken as double .

Which programming language uses long double?

Some programming languages like C use long double that gives more precision than double. Check out the different data types of C.

Is it possible to use double in Java?

If you work with small quantities of data – like average marks, area of triangle etc… use double by default. But, if you deal with a lot of numbers where high precision is involved and any rounding off can change results – like trigonometry, width of a human hair, neural networks, spin of an electron, coordinates of a location and so on – it is important to know about the differences between float and double. While Java encourages you to use double, in languages like C you have the flexibility of using whichever you want.

How many digits are in a double?

A double is a double-precision, 64-bit floating-point data type. It accommodates 15 to 16 digits, with a range of approximately 5.0 × 10 −345 to 1.7 × 10 308.

What is double type in C++?

The double is a fundamental data type built into the compiler and used to define numeric variables holding numbers with decimal points. C, C++, C# and many other programming languages recognize the double as a type. A double type can represent fractional as well as whole values. It can contain up to 15 digits in total, including those before and after the decimal point.

Why is float faster than double?

The float type, which has a smaller range, was used at one time because it was faster than the double when dealing with thousands or millions of floating-point numbers. Because calculation speed has increased dramatically with new processors, however, the advantages of floats over doubles are negligible.

image

1.What Is a Double in C, C++ and C# Programming?

Url:https://www.thoughtco.com/definition-of-double-958065

12 hours ago The double is a fundamental data type built into the compiler and used to define numeric variables holding numbers with decimal points. C, C++, C# and many other programming languages recognize the double as a type. A double type can represent fractional as well as …

2.Double Data Type - Visual Basic | Microsoft Learn

Url:https://learn.microsoft.com/en-us/dotnet/visual-basic/language-reference/data-types/double-data-type

12 hours ago  · The Double data type provides the largest and smallest possible magnitudes for a number. The default value of Double is 0. Programming Tips. Precision. When you work with …

3.Videos of What Is a double Value

Url:/videos/search?q=what+is+a+double+value&qpvt=what+is+a+double+value&FORM=VDRE

29 hours ago  · Double (double-precision floating-point) variables are stored as IEEE 64-bit (8-byte) floating-point numbers ranging in value from:-1.79769313486231E308 to …

4.Double data type | Microsoft Learn

Url:https://learn.microsoft.com/en-us/office/vba/language/reference/user-interface-help/double-data-type

27 hours ago A double has 8 bytes, which is equal to 64 bits in size. In double data type, the 1 bit for sign representation, 11 bits for the exponent and the remaining 52 bits used for the mantissa. The …

5.What is double in C? - Java

Url:https://www.javatpoint.com/what-is-double-in-c

15 hours ago Result after being converted to double value = 22.8 Result after being converted to double value = 224.0

6.Java Double doubleValue() Method with Examples

Url:https://www.javatpoint.com/java-double-doublevalue-method

30 hours ago The Java double keyword is a primitive data type. It is a double-precision 64-bit IEEE 754 floating point. It is used to declare the variables and methods. It

7.Difference Between float vs double Data Types [Updated]

Url:https://hackr.io/blog/float-vs-double

7 hours ago  · What is a double value? The double variable can hold very large (or small) numbers. The maximum and minimum values are 17 followed by 307 zeros. The double …

8.What does this (double absolute value like) notation mean?

Url:https://math.stackexchange.com/questions/1707269/what-does-this-double-absolute-value-like-notation-mean

36 hours ago  · float fnum = (float) 2.344; Double is the default decimal point type for Java. double dnum = 2.344; If high precision is not required and the program only needs a huge array of …

9.c - Printf a double - Stack Overflow

Url:https://stackoverflow.com/questions/72847579/printf-a-double

7 hours ago  · $\begingroup$ @AmirBigdeli It is sometimes not written as $|a|$ to avoid confusion with the absolute value of a number. People usually start writing it as $|a|$ again …

A B C D E F G H I J K L M N O P Q R S T U V W X Y Z 1 2 3 4 5 6 7 8 9